Lua:Neutrino-API:touch:de

Aus TuxBoxWIKI
Version vom 10. September 2016, 21:05 Uhr von Micha-bbg (Diskussion | Beiträge) (1 Version importiert)
(Unterschied) ← Nächstältere Version | Aktuelle Version (Unterschied) | Nächstjüngere Version → (Unterschied)
Wechseln zu: Navigation, Suche

touch

Setzt die Zeit einer angegebenen Datei auf einen bestimmten Wert. Ohne Angabe wird due aktuelle Zeit verwendet.
Wenn die Datei nicht existiert, wird sie neu angelegt.
Rückgabewert: Boolean

touch(Parameter) ab API v1.50   -   Neutrino Git


Parameter:

Parameter Typ Description/Beschreibung
1 string Objekt zu bearbeitende Datei, Verzeichnis
2 number Zeit Zeitangabe in Unixzeit, Default: aktuelle Zeit
en: Parameters with default-values are optional. If not needed, no definition is required. In case of missing parameter, default value is used.

de: Parameter mit Default-Wert sind optional. dh. sie müssen nicht angegeben werden. Falls der Parameter fehlt, wird automatisch dieser Wert angenommen.


Example:

local fh = filehelpers.new()

-- Setzt die Dateizeit von '/tmp/wichtich' auf den 1.4.1959 5 Uhr:
local t = os.time({ year = 1959, day = 1, month = 4, hour=5})
ret = fh:touch("/tmp/wichtich", t)
-- Rückgabewert true